North Carolina has a 4.75 percent state sales tax rate, a max local sales tax rate of 2.75 percent, and an average combined state and local sales tax rate of 6.98 percent. 2). Here's a simple example of how it would work in Alabama, where there are three tax brackets that start at $0, $500, and $3,000 of income, taxed at 2%, 4%, and 5%, respectively: Under that system, someone earning $10,000 a year would pay $460 altogether in state taxes. For example, someone who lives in Colorado is going to pay 4.55% of their taxable income in taxes to the state whether it's someone earning $100,000 who pays $4,550 or someone earning $10,000 who pays $455.
